Noyon
Noyon is a village in Canappeville, Arrondissement of Bernay, Normandy. Noyon is situated nearby to the hamlet Les Landes, as well as near the village Canappeville.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Louviers
Town
Photo: Theoliane, Public domain.
Louviers is a commune in the Eure department in Normandy in north-western France. Louviers is 100 km from Paris and 30 km from Rouen. Louviers is situated 10 km northeast of Noyon.
